Offensive formations
Prior to the ball is snapped the offensive team lines up within a formation. Most teams Have got a "foundation" formation they prefer to line up in, though other teams leave the protection guessing. Teams will typically have "Specific formations" which they only use in noticeable passing situations, limited yardage or goaline cases, or formations they have got developed for that individual recreation in order to confuse the defense. Simply because there are a virtually limitless range of possible formations, only some of the a lot more frequent kinds are detailed beneath.
Professional Set
The professional Established is a standard formation commonly, a "base" established used by Experienced and amateur teams. The formation has two vast receivers, one particular limited end, and two operating backs While using the backs split behind the quarterback, that is lined up at the rear of Middle. The jogging backs are lined up side-by-side instead of 1 before one other as in conventional I-Development sets.
Shotgun formation
The Shotgun formation is an alignment employed by the offensive team in American and Canadian soccer. This formation is utilized by several teams in obvious passing cases, Even though other teams do use this as their foundation formation. From the shotgun, rather than the quarterback getting the snap from Middle at the road of scrimmage, he stands not less than five yards again. At times the quarterback will have a back on a person or either side prior to the snap, although other occasions he would be the lone player within the backfield with everyone unfold out as receivers. Considered one of some great benefits of the shotgun development are the passer has additional time and energy to put in place from the pocket which provides him a 2nd or two to Track down open up receivers. A further benefit is always that standing additional again from the road before the snap presents the quarterback a greater "search" within the defensive alignment. The down sides are the protection is familiar with a go is much more than possible developing (although some managing performs is usually run correctly within the shotgun) and there is a greater risk of a botched snap than in a straightforward Heart/quarterback Trade.
The formation got its name immediately after it absolutely was used by an experienced football club, the San Francisco 49ers, in 1960. Combining components of the quick punt and distribute formations ("spread" in that it had receivers spread greatly in lieu of near or guiding the inside line players), it absolutely was said for being like a "shotgun" in spraying receivers throughout the subject similar to a scatter-shot gun. Formations identical or just like the shotgun utilized a long time Formerly might be termed names including "distribute double wing". Shorter punt formations (so termed mainly because the gap between the snapper as well as the ostensible punter is shorter than in very long punt development) Never normally have just as much emphasis on large receivers.
Sometimes the formation continues to be much more common in Canadian football, which makes it possible for only three downs to maneuver 10 yards downfield as an alternative to the American recreation's 4. Canadian teams are as a result extra very likely to come across on their own with long yardage for making on the penultimate down, and therefore extra very likely to line up within the shotgun to improve their chances for a sizable attain. Groups including the Saskatchewan Roughriders benefit from the shotgun for just a overwhelming majority in their performs.
Wishbone formation
The wishbone formation, also acknowledged just as 'bone, is actually a play formation in American football.
The wishbone is mostly a jogging development with a person huge receiver, just one restricted end and a few operating backs powering the quarterback (who takes the snap below Middle). The again lined up guiding the quarterback is definitely the fullback and one other two are halfbacks (While They could be identified as tailbacks or I backs in a few playbook terminology).
The wishbone is frequently linked to the choice as this development permits the quarterback to easily operate the choice to either facet of the road. It's also ideal for managing the triple selection.
Heritage
The wishbone was designed by Offensive Coordinator Emory Bellard and Head Coach Darrell Royal in the College of Texas in 1968. Coach Royal was generally a enthusiast of the choice offense, As well as in investigating the personnel over the crew, Mentor Bellard noticed a few good functioning backs. Just after experimenting with members of the family over the summer months, Coach Bellard came up Using the formation.
Mentor Bellard demonstrated the formation to Darrell Royal, who immediately embraced The reasoning. It proved to become a wise option: Texas tied its initial match working the new offense, misplaced the 2nd, after which won the following thirty straight game titles, bringing about two National Championships utilizing the development.
It was presented the title wishbone with the Houston Chronicle sportswriter Mickey Herskowitz.
A variation to this formation is known as the flexbone.
I development
The I development is one of the most frequent offensive formations in American football. The I development attracts its name through the vertical (as viewed in the opposing endzone) alignment of quarterback, fullback, and jogging back, especially when contrasted While using the exact same gamers' alignments while in the now-archaic T formation.
The development commences with the standard five offensive linemen (2 offensive tackles, 2 guards, in addition to a center), the quarterback underneath Middle, and two backs Miami Dolphins jerseys in-line powering the quarterback. The bottom variant provides a decent conclude to at least one aspect of the road and two wide receivers, one at Every single end of the road.
Standard roles
The I development is typically used in working predicaments. The fullback commonly fills a blocking, rather then rushing or getting, position in the trendy sport. With the fullback from the backfield as being a blocker, runs is often produced to possibly side of the road together with his supplemental blocking assist. That is contrasted with the use of limited ends as blockers who, getting set up at the end of the road, can easily help operates to at least one facet of the road only. The fullback can also be utilised like a feint--since the defense can spot him extra very easily in comparison to the managing back again, They could be drawn in his path although the operating back again normally takes the ball the opposite way.
Despite the emphasis within the jogging recreation, the I development continues to be a good base to get a passing assault. The development supports up to a few broad receivers and many operating backs function an additional receiving menace. Even though the fullback isn't a go receiver, he serves being a capable further pass blocker shielding the quarterback prior to the go. The functioning menace posed by the development also lends by itself on the Engage in-motion move. The versatile mother nature with the development also allows reduce defenses from concentrating their attention on both the run or move.
Typical variations
Many subtypes of your I formation exist, normally emphasizing the managing or passing strengths of The bottom Model.
* The Big I destinations a decent close on either side in the offensive line (getting rid of a large receiver). Coupled While using the fullback's blocking, This permits two added blockers for your run in both route. This is the functioning-emphasis variant.
* The facility I replaces just one extensive receiver with a third back again (fullback or jogging back again) during the backfield, create to at least one aspect of the fullback. It is a functioning-emphasis variant.
* The Jumbo or Intention-line development more extends the ability I or Significant I, introducing a next or third restricted conclude to the line, respectively. This variant has no wide receivers which is all but solely a functioning formation meant to reliably achieve negligible yardage, most commonly two yards or fewer.
* The A few-broad I replaces the tight conclude with a third vast receiver. This is a passing-emphasis variant.
The I formation, in almost any variant, can even be modified as Robust or Weak. In either circumstance, the fullback traces up roughly a lawn laterally to his usual situation. Powerful refers to a go in the direction of the facet of the quarterback with much more players, weak in the alternative way. These modifications have little impact on expected Perform contact.
In Experienced Football
Inside the NFL, the I formation is fewer routinely utilized than in higher education, as using the fullback for a blocker has specified solution to formations with supplemental limited ends and huge receivers, who could possibly be identified as on to dam through running plays. The ever more frequent ace formation replaces the fullback with an extra receiver, who strains up alongside the line of scrimmage. The I will commonly be applied in short-yardage and goal line situations.
